Intel Core i7 1260P vs Intel Core i7 11850H

We compared two laptop CPUs: Intel Core i7 1260P with 12 cores 2.1GHz and Intel Core i7 11850H with 8 cores 2.1G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i7 1260P 's Advantages
Released 9 months late
Better graphics card performance
Higher specification of memory (LPDDR5-5200 vs DDR4-3200)
Larger memory bandwidth (76.8GB/s vs 51.2GB/s)
Lower TDP (28W vs 35W)
Intel Core i7 11850H 's Advantages
Higher base frequency (2.5GHz vs 2.1GHz)
Larger L3 cache size (24MB vs 18MB)
